Taylor Swift and Travis Kelce Marry at Madison Square Garden in High-Security Star-Studded Ceremony
Taylor Swift and Travis Kelce were married at Madison Square Garden in a tightly controlled, celebrity-filled ceremony. The wedding drew a roster of A-list guests, including Tom Hanks, Paul McCartney, Steven Spielberg and Selena Gomez, alongside prominent media figures from Good Morning America. Security was exceptionally strict: guests had their phones confiscated and signed binding non-disclosure agreements, and Madison Square Garden subsequently dismissed employees who breached the confidentiality terms.
The venue was extensively redecorated for the occasion, with peach-coloured décor applied throughout the interior to the point that attendees described the space as virtually unrecognisable. Beyond the spectacle, the marriage marks a notable moment in Swift's two-decade career, whose songwriting has long chronicled shifting perspectives on love and commitment, from the romantic idealism of her early work to more recent explorations of emotional complexity and disillusionment.
